Liontrust Asset Management plc is a British asset management company based in London. It is list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 Index.[2]
History
The company, which was established in 1995, was the subject of an initial public offering on the London Stock Exchange in 1999.[3] It acquired Alliance Trust Investment Management in December 2016[4] and bought Neptune Investment Management in October 2019.[5] After incurring an outflow of £0.5 billion, the company created a new investment management team in July 2022.[6]
